Mark Masonry.

KINTORE LODGE ( Nc . 333 ) . —The second regular meeting of this promising young lodge svas held at the Surrey Masonic Hall , Camberwell Nesv-road , on Monday , the 12 th inst . Present : Bros . G . H . Newington Bridges , W . AL ; T . Poore , acting LP . AL ; J . H . Hastie , J . VV . ; C . Fountain , AI . O . ; B . R . Bryant , G . Std . Br ., J . O . ; C . H . Nevili , Sec ; G . Norrington , S . D . ; R . C . Ingram , J . D . ; G . J . Venables , LG . ; J . VV . Routledge ,

R . M . ; R . A . Alarshall , D . C ; J . S . Terry , Stsvd . ; J . E . Tidd , and others . Visitors : Bros . V . T . A-lurche , S . D . 22 ; R . J . Voisey , VV . M . 22 "; J . Holliday , P . G . Std . Br . Middx . and Surrey , W . AI . 234 ; and Seymour Smith , Org . 22 . In the absence , through bereavement , of Bro . T . Edmonston , the chair of S . W . svas occupied by Bro . Nevili , and the minutes of the previous meeting having been read

and confirmed , the follosving brethren were advanced to the honourable Degree of M . M . M .: Bros . VV . S . R . Payne , VV . AI . 1 CG 9 ; and Sidney F . Hill , Org . 121 G . The beautiful ceremonial svas rendered in a manner for svhich this lodge , young as it is , is already becoming famous . The proposed bye-lasvs of the lodge svere then read and approved , and candidates having been proposed for advancement at the next meeting , the W . AL then announced that the Prov .

Grand Lodge of Aliddlesex and' Surrey had accepted thc invitation to hold the next annual meeting under the banner of the Kintore Lodge , and had fixed Alonday , the 1 st of June , for that meeting . On the motion of the J . W ., seconded by the W . W ., it svas agreed unanimously that the Secretary be instructed to forsvard a letter of condolence to Bro . T . Edmonston , S . W . The lodge having been closed , the brethren adjourned to

the banqueting room , svere a most enjoyable evening svas concluded . The beauty of the ceremonies in lodge , as svell as the enjoyment of the latter part of the evening , svere materially increased by the able manner in svhich Bro . Seymour Smith presided at the organ and piano .

The excellent svorking of the officers of this lodge is due mainly to the assiduity svith svhich they have attended the Kintore Lodge of Instruction , founded by them , and held at the Stirling Castle Hotel , * Camber \ vell , every Friday , at nine p . m ., under the guidance of VV . Bro . Thos . Poore , P . G . I . G ., Preceptor .

The Craft Abroad.

The Craft Abroad .

THE NETHERLANDS . We learn from a communication in La Chaine cl ' Union for December from the correspondent of that journal in the Hague that the scheme originated by some zealous brethren of Amsterdam for the purpose of au-rmentinir thi > fnnrU r , t

the "Louisa Stichting Orphanage" by means of an exposition and art lottery , proved very successful , the amount settled by the committee of management , and by them remitted to the executive of the Orphanage , being upwards of 42 , 000 francs ( £ i 6 So ) .

AIASONIC INSTRUCTION . We read in the current number of the Voice of Masonry that Bro . John R . Thomas , Grand Alaster of the Grand Lodge of Illinois , has appointed that schools of instruction shall be held at certain places on certain days in January , February , and Alarch , the object of such meetinirs beine

to enable Alasters and other officers of the lodges of this grand jurisdiction , as far as possible , to witness a full exemplification of the ceremonials incident to the conferring of the various degrees of Symbolic Masonry , and to learn the svork and lectures as adopted by the Grand Lodge . The Grand Master points out that " it is not only the privi-

The Craft Abroad.

lege , but also the first duty of every lodge officer to become proficient in the standard svork of the jurisdiction , " and he expresses a hope that "each locality svill be fully represented , " and that the brethren svho attend " svill come determined and prepared to study and svork , so that the most progress possible svill be made . "

GRAND CHAPTER OF VIRGINIA . The Seventy-seventh Annual Convocation of the Grand Chapter of Royal Arch Alasons in Virginia svas held in Lexington tosvards the close of last October . M . E . Comp . W . H . H . Lynn presided as acting Grand High Priest , and fifteen chapters svere represented . Action in reference to the Anglo-Quebec difficulty svas deferred for a year , it being very svisely considered that the parties in

disagreement svere competent to settle their osvn differences svithout trying " to involve the svhole Masonic svorld in their petty quarrel . " We should like to see more of the American Alasonic bodies animated by the same spirit as this Grand Chapter . Had there been little or no hope on the part of pigmy Quebec that the outer svorld svould sympathise svith it in its contest svith the giant England , sve should probably have heard nothing of this " petty quarrel , " and sve should have been all the better for hearing nothing .

Obituary.

Obituary .

R . W BRO . WILLIAM ELIOT , P . P . G . M . DORSETSHIRE . We announce svith regret the death of R . W . Bro . William Eliot , Past Prov . G . Master of Dorsetshire . Bro . Eliot , svho svas aged 91 years , svas initiated in the All Souls Lodge , No . 170 , Weymouth , in 1 S 16 , and svas installed W . M . in 1 S 19 . In the year 1 S 39 , the late Duke of Sussex

appointed him Prov . G . Alaster of Dorsetshire , svhich office he resigned in 1 S 46 . He svas also a P . Z . of All Souls Chapter , No . 170 , Weymouth , and P . Prov . G . Superintendent of R . A . Alasons in Dorsetshire during the years 1 S 41-45 . Bro . Eliot had continued a subscribing member of his mother-lodge from the date of his initiation till bis death on Monday , or for 6 9 years , svhich is probably a

longer period of subscription than is to be found in the case of any other living Mason . The lodge of Friendship and Sincerity , No . 472 , Shaftesbury , svhose svarrant bears date the 17 th of October , 1 S 40 , still flourishes as a memorial of the Masonic doings in Dorsetshire , in the days long since gone by svhen our late brother svas the respected Alaster of the Province .

BRO . LIEUT .-COL . BURNABY . Bro . Col . Burnaby svho svas slain in the battle svith the Alahdi ' s forces , svhich took place on Saturday last at the Abu Klea Wells , was one of the most brilliant as well as one of the most popular officers in the British Army . He received his first commission in the Royal Horse Guards in 1859 , svhen iS years of age , and having risen through

the intermediate grades , svas promoted Lieut .-Col . in 1 SS 1 . He svas present at the battle of EI Teb last year , and svas the first to mount the parapet of the fort svhich the Soudanese had erected , being , with Baker Pasha and others , severely svounded on the occasion . In the present expedition he was attached to the Intelligence Department of Sir Herbert Stesvart's force , and the latest news received

about him svas to thc effect that he had successfully conducted a convoy from Korti to Gakdul . Our late brother , hosvever , svill be chiefly remembered by his famous " Ride to Khiva , " and " On Horseback through Asia Minor , " the former expedition having been undertaken in 1 S 75 , and having first brought him into public notice . He svas in Plevna during the Russo-Turkish svar in 1 S 77 , and , in fact ,

had taken every opportunity of acquiring a practical knosvledge of the profession of svhich he svas so bright an ornament . Bro . Lieut .-Col . Burnaby svas initiated in the Alma Mater Lodge , No . 1644 , Birmingham , on the 21 st November , 1879 , but the busy life he had since led had prevented him taking an active part in the proceedings of the Craft . ¦

Bro . JOHN WHICHCORD , P . G . A . D . C . Bro . John Whichcord , F . S . A ., Past A . G . D . of C , whose funeral took place at Kensal Green Cemetery , on Thursday , the 15 th inst ., svas initiated in the Jerusalem Lodge , No . 197 , and svas its Treasurer for many years . He svas a founder and acted as the first P . M . of the Buckingham and Chandos Lodge , No . 1150 , in 1 SG 7 , and in 1873 occupied

the chair of First Principal in St . James ' s Chapter ( R A . ) , No . 2 . In 1 S 73 he svas appointed G . Assistant Director of Ceremonies in United Grand Lodge . He was a Life Governor of the Benevolent Institution ( Female Fund ) and Girls' School , and a Life Subscriber of the Boys' School , and had served the office of Festival Stesvard once for each

of the three Institutions . Among those svho attended the obsequies of our deceased brother , svere Bros . Sir John B . Alonckton , P . G . J . W . and Sir C . Hatton Gregory . K . C . M . G ., P . G . D ., the President and several members of the Council of the Institute of British Architects , and deputations from he Institute of Civil Engineers , & c , & c .
